Widely Used Tree Trimming Techniques You Should Know

Tree trimming applies various techniques crafted to foster healthy growth and improve aesthetic appeal. One well-known technique is crown thinning, which entails carefully cutting branches to boost light penetration and air circulation within the tree. This method enhances overall health while maintaining the tree's natural form. Another frequent method is crown reduction, used to reduce the height of a tree while maintaining its structure. This is especially helpful for trees that threaten nearby structures. Furthermore, deadwooding is a technique focusing on the removal of dead or diseased branches to prevent the transmission of pests and diseases. Lastly, directional pruning guides growth in certain directions, allowing for better landscape design and preventing obstructions. Having knowledge of these techniques allows property owners to make informed choices about their tree care, promoting a healthier and more visually appealing landscape.

Frequently Asked Questions

How regularly Should I book Tree Trimming Services?

Tree trimming offerings should typically be scheduled every 1 to 3 years, based on the tree species, growth speed, and local weather patterns. Regular evaluations can assist in preserving tree health and prevent potential dangers.

What Is the Best Time for Tree Pruning?

The best season for tree cutting is the period spanning late winter to early spring, before new foliage begins. This timing reduces pressure on the plants and allows for improved recovery, promoting vigorous healthy growth that flourishes subsequently.

Can Tree Trimming Damage My Trees?

Tree pruning can harm trees if done incorrectly or excessively, causing stress, disease, or structural complications. However, when performed correctly and at appropriate intervals, it enhances health and longevity in trees. Proper techniques are indispensable.

Do I Have to Be Home During the Trimming?

A homeowner's presence during tree trimming is seldom necessary. Professionals can adeptly execute the job solo, assuring safety and quality. However, some may choose to be home for communication and to address concerns directly.

What Is the Typical Cost of Professional Tree Trimming?

Professional tree cutting services typically fall between $200 and $1,500, based on factors like tree size, location, and work difficulty. Additional charges may be added for specialized services or urgent requests.
